I'm exporting a document to a .txt file with Tab-key formatting for a column appearance.

When I copy from Notepad and paste into the text editor, I lose some of the Tabs, not all. If I manually fix the problem in MyInfo and go to print preview, everything is all over the place. If I go back to the original copy-paste and preview, it looks like it did Notepad.

I am not sure why this happens. On my test machine the problem occurs too, although not exactly like on yours. I have contacted the author of the text editing library MyInfo uses for advice.

Meanwhile you can test with a smaller tab size (Tools > Options > Editor > Tab Size in Pixels). It seems to help, but you probably need to reformat the text again..
